Answer:
4^12 y^24
Explanation:
(16y^5/4y^3)^12
Simplify inside the parentheses
(16/4 * y^5/y^3) ^ 12
When dividing the bases to the exponent, we keep the base and subtract the exponent
(4 y^(5-3)) ^12
(4 y^2) ^12
Remember (ab)^c = a^c * b^c
4^12 y^2^12
When we have a power to a power, we can multiply the exponents
a^b^c =a^(b*c)
4^12 y^(2*12)
4^12 y^24
